For decades, Nashville has been the beating heart of Christian and Gospel music, yet a dedicated space to honor its profound legacy remained a dream—until now. “People have longed for this museum as long as the music itself has thrived here,” shares Executive Director Steve Gilreath. The C&G will transcend traditional exhibits, offering an immersive experience where visitors can remix timeless hymns, witness rare memorabilia, and even stand where legends once stood. The museum will pulse with life through live performances, intimate artist encounters, and dynamic workshops, ensuring every guest doesn’t just observe the music but feels it. Kicking off the Legacy Series, 16-time Dove Award winner Russ Taff will serve as the inaugural Artist in Residence, offering fans an unforgettable glimpse into his storied career.

GMA President Jackie Patillo reflects, “This museum is the fulfillment of our mission to Expose, Promote, and Celebrate the Gospel through music in all its forms.” From Southern Gospel’s rich harmonies to the bold beats of Holy Hip-Hop, The C&G will amplify the diverse voices that have carried faith’s message through song.
